In a world where travel has become more accessible than ever before, finding the cheapest flight tickets has become something of an art form. Whether you're planning a weekend getaway or a month-long adventure, saving money on airfare can make a significant difference in your overall travel budget. Fortunately, with a bit of know-how and some savvy strategies, you can score great deals on flights to destinations near and far. Here are some tips to help you find the cheapest flight tickets for your next adventure.
Be Flexible with Your Travel Dates: One of the most effective ways to save money on flights is by being flexible with your travel dates. Prices can vary significantly depending on the day of the week, time of year, and even the time of day you choose to fly. By being open to different departure and return dates, you can often find cheaper options that fit within your schedule.
Book in Advance (or at the Last Minute): Generally, booking your flight well in advance can help you snag lower prices, especially for popular routes and peak travel times. However, there are also instances where airlines offer last-minute deals to fill empty seats. Keeping an eye on fares and being ready to pounce when you see a good deal can sometimes result in significant savings.
Use Fare Comparison Websites: With numerous fare comparison websites and apps available, finding the cheapest flight tickets has never been easier. These platforms allow you to compare prices across multiple airlines and booking sites, helping you find the best deals without spending hours scouring the internet.
Sign Up for Price Alerts: Many travel websites and airlines offer price alert services that notify you when prices drop for a specific route or destination. By signing up for these alerts, you can stay informed about the latest deals and snatch up discounted tickets before they sell out.
Consider Alternative Airports: Flying into smaller or less popular airports can often result in cheaper fares compared to major hubs. While it may require a bit of extra travel time or ground transportation, the savings can be well worth it, especially for budget-conscious travelers.
Utilize Airline Rewards Programs: If you frequently travel with a particular airline or alliance, joining their rewards program can help you earn miles and redeem them for free or discounted flights in the future. Additionally, many airlines offer co-branded credit cards that come with perks like bonus miles, free checked bags, and priority boarding.
Be Open to Layovers: While non-stop flights are convenient, they often come with a premium price tag. If you're willing to endure a layover or two, you can often find significantly cheaper options, especially for long-haul journeys. Just be sure to factor in the additional travel time and potential hassle of navigating multiple airports.
Clear Your Browser Cookies: Some studies suggest that airlines and booking sites may track your online activity and adjust prices accordingly. To avoid potential price hikes, try clearing your browser cookies or using an incognito/private browsing window when searching for flights.
Book One-Way Tickets: In some cases, booking two separate one-way tickets instead of a round-trip ticket can result in lower overall costs. This is especially true when flying with budget airlines or when the cheapest fare for each leg of the journey is offered by different carriers.
Negotiate with Airlines Directly: While it may not always work, contacting airlines directly and negotiating prices can sometimes lead to unexpected savings, especially if you encounter a friendly and accommodating customer service representative.
Finding the cheapest flight tickets requires patience, flexibility, and a willingness to explore various options. By employing these savvy strategies and staying informed about the latest deals and promotions, you can maximize your travel budget and make your dream destinations a reality.

Sky-High Savings: Flight Booking Strategies
In an age where travel is more accessible than ever, finding the best deals on flights has become an art form. Whether you're a seasoned jet-setter or a first-time traveler, mastering the ins and outs of flight booking can save you a significant amount of money. From timing your purchase to leveraging loyalty programs, there are numerous strategies you can employ to secure sky-high savings on your next adventure.

1. Plan Ahead, but Not Too Far Ahead
One of the golden rules of flight booking is to plan ahead. Generally, booking your flights well in advance can lead to substantial savings. Airlines often offer lower fares for those who book tickets months before their departure date. However, it's essential to strike a balance. Booking too far in advance may mean missing out on last-minute deals or fare drops closer to your travel date. Aim to book your flights around 1-3 months before departure for the optimal combination of choice and price.
2. Be Flexible with Your Travel Dates
Flexibility is key when it comes to finding the best flight deals. Being open to flying on different days of the week or during off-peak hours can result in significant savings. Use flexible date search tools provided by various booking websites to compare prices across a range of dates and identify the cheapest options. Additionally, consider traveling during shoulder seasons or off-peak times for your destination, as flights are often cheaper when demand is lower.
3. Use Price Comparison Websites
With a plethora of online booking platforms available, comparing prices across multiple sites is essential for snagging the best deals. Utilize price comparison websites such as Skyscanner, Google Flights, or Kayak to quickly compare fares from various airlines and travel agencies. These platforms often offer features like fare alerts, which notify you when prices drop for your desired route, helping you secure the best possible deal.
4. Take Advantage of Loyalty Programs
Frequent flyers can leverage airline loyalty programs to accumulate miles or points that can be redeemed for discounted or free flights in the future. Sign up for loyalty programs offered by airlines you frequently travel with, and make sure to input your membership number when booking flights to earn rewards. Additionally, consider applying for credit cards affiliated with airlines or travel rewards programs to earn bonus miles or points on your everyday spending.
5. Consider Alternative Airports
When planning your trip, explore the possibility of flying into or out of alternative airports near your destination. Larger airports often have higher fees and taxes, resulting in more expensive flights. By opting for smaller or secondary airports, you may find cheaper fares without sacrificing convenience. Keep in mind transportation costs to and from the airport when considering this strategy, as savings on flights could be offset by additional expenses.
6. Clear Your Browser Cookies
Believe it or not, airlines and booking websites may track your online activity and adjust prices accordingly. To avoid potential price hikes, clear your browser cookies or use an incognito or private browsing mode when searching for flights. This prevents websites from identifying you as a returning visitor and potentially raising prices based on your search history.
7. Stay Alert for Flash Sales and Promotions
Keep your eyes peeled for flash sales, promotions, and mistake fares, which can offer unbeatable savings on flights. Follow airlines and travel deal websites on social media, subscribe to their newsletters, and set up fare alerts to stay informed about any limited-time offers. Act quickly when you spot a fantastic deal, as these promotions often have limited availability and sell out fast.
8. Bundle Your Travel Expenses
Consider bundling your flights with other travel expenses, such as accommodation or rental cars, to unlock additional savings. Many booking websites offer discounts for booking packages, allowing you to save money on multiple aspects of your trip simultaneously. Just be sure to compare prices carefully to ensure you're getting the best overall deal.
By incorporating these flight booking strategies into your travel planning process, you can maximize your savings and make your dream destinations more affordable than ever before. Whether you're jetting off for a weekend getaway or embarking on a round-the-world adventure, a little savvy planning can go a long way in stretching your travel budget.

Flight Ticket Booking: Making Informed Decisions for a Seamless Journey
In an age where technology has revolutionized the way we travel, booking flight tickets has become more accessible and convenient than ever before. With numerous online platforms and travel agencies vying for our attention, the process of booking a flight can sometimes feel overwhelming. However, armed with the right knowledge and tools, travelers can make informed decisions that not only save them money but also ensure a seamless journey from start to finish.

Understanding Your Options
One of the first steps in booking a flight ticket is understanding the plethora of options available. From budget airlines to full-service carriers, each offers a different set of amenities, pricing structures, and routes. While budget airlines may offer lower fares, they often come with additional fees for services such as checked baggage, seat selection, and in-flight meals. On the other hand, full-service carriers typically include these amenities in the ticket price but may be more expensive upfront.
When choosing an airline, it's essential to consider factors such as baggage allowance, onboard amenities, seat comfort, and overall reputation for customer service. Reading reviews from other travelers can provide valuable insights into the quality of the airline's offerings and help you make an informed decision.
Timing Is Key
Timing plays a crucial role in securing the best deals on flight tickets. Airlines typically release their flight schedules and fares several months in advance, with prices often fluctuating based on factors such as demand, time of booking, and day of the week. Generally, booking your flight well in advance can help you snag lower fares, especially for popular travel dates and destinations.
Additionally, being flexible with your travel dates can result in significant savings. Traveling during off-peak seasons or opting for mid-week flights can often yield lower prices compared to peak travel times. Furthermore, keeping an eye out for flash sales, promotions, and last-minute deals can also lead to substantial savings on your flight tickets.
Comparing Prices
With a multitude of online travel agencies and booking platforms available, comparing prices has never been easier. Utilizing search engines and aggregators allows travelers to compare fares across multiple airlines and booking sites simultaneously, ensuring that they get the best possible deal. Additionally, many airlines offer price-match guarantees, promising to refund the difference if a lower fare is found on another platform.
When comparing prices, it's essential to consider the total cost of the ticket, including any additional fees or taxes. Some booking sites may advertise lower base fares but tack on extra charges during the checkout process, ultimately inflating the overall cost. Reading the fine print and understanding the terms and conditions associated with your booking can help you avoid any unpleasant surprises later on.
Maximizing Rewards and Benefits
For frequent travelers, loyalty programs and travel rewards can provide additional value and perks when booking flight tickets. Many airlines offer loyalty programs that allow members to earn points or miles for every dollar spent on flights, which can then be redeemed for free flights, upgrades, or other benefits. Additionally, co-branded credit cards often come with sign-up bonuses, accelerated earning rates, and exclusive benefits such as priority boarding, lounge access, and complimentary checked bags.
By strategically leveraging loyalty programs and travel rewards, travelers can stretch their travel budget further and enjoy a more comfortable and rewarding travel experience.
Finalizing Your Booking
Once you've found the perfect flight at the right price, it's time to finalize your booking. Before completing your purchase, double-check all the details, including travel dates, times, and passenger information, to ensure accuracy. It's also a good idea to review the airline's cancellation and change policies in case your plans need to be adjusted later on.
When entering payment information, be sure to use a secure and trusted payment method to protect your personal and financial data. Many booking sites offer encryption and other security measures to safeguard sensitive information, but it's always wise to exercise caution when sharing payment details online.
Conclusion
Booking flight tickets can be a daunting task, but with the right knowledge and approach, travelers can navigate the process with ease. By understanding their options, timing their bookings strategically, comparing prices diligently, maximizing rewards and benefits, and finalizing their bookings securely, travelers can make informed decisions that lead to a seamless journey from takeoff to touchdown.

The Evolution of Flight Ticket Booking: From Travel Agencies to Online Platforms
In the not-so-distant past, booking a flight ticket meant a visit to a travel agency, where a travel agent would sift through thick binders of flight schedules, call airlines for availability, and manually book your desired itinerary. Fast forward to today, and the process has undergone a monumental transformation, thanks to the advent of online booking platforms. The evolution of flight ticket booking from traditional travel agencies to digital platforms has revolutionized the way we plan and purchase air travel. Let's delve into this fascinating journey of transformation.

The Rise of Travel Agencies:
Before the internet era, travel agencies were the primary gatekeepers of flight ticket booking. These brick-and-mortar establishments served as one-stop shops for all travel-related needs, including booking flights, hotels, rental cars, and vacation packages. Travel agents played a pivotal role in assisting customers with itinerary planning, providing destination information, and navigating the complexities of airline pricing and regulations.
Travel agencies thrived on personal interactions and expertise. Customers relied on their knowledge and connections to secure the best deals and ensure hassle-free travel experiences. However, this personalized service came with limitations, such as limited operating hours, geographical constraints, and the need for in-person visits or phone calls to make bookings.
The Dawn of Online Booking Platforms:
The advent of the internet marked a paradigm shift in the travel industry. Online booking platforms emerged as disruptors, offering convenience, accessibility, and a vast array of options at the click of a button. Websites like Expedia, Travelocity, and Orbitz pioneered the online travel agency (OTA) model, allowing users to search, compare, and book flights, hotels, and other travel services from anywhere with an internet connection.
The appeal of online booking platforms was manifold. They provided real-time access to global flight inventories, enabling users to compare prices across multiple airlines instantly. Moreover, the transparent pricing and availability information empowered consumers to make informed decisions without relying on intermediaries.
The Advantages of Online Booking Platforms:
Online booking platforms introduced several advantages over traditional travel agencies:
Convenience: Users can search and book flights 24/7 from the comfort of their homes or on-the-go via mobile apps.
Choice: Online platforms offer a vast selection of airlines, routes, and fare options, allowing users to find the best deals tailored to their preferences.
Cost Savings: Competition among airlines and OTAs often leads to competitive pricing and exclusive discounts, saving travelers money.
Flexibility: Users can easily modify or cancel bookings online, often with minimal fees, providing greater flexibility in travel planning.
User Reviews: Platforms integrate user reviews and ratings, helping travelers make informed decisions based on peer experiences.
The Role of Technology in Streamlining Booking Processes:
Technological advancements have played a pivotal role in streamlining the flight booking process. Features such as predictive analytics, dynamic pricing algorithms, and personalized recommendations have enhanced user experience and efficiency. Additionally, innovations like virtual reality tours, interactive maps, and chatbots have augmented engagement and customer support.
Mobile technology has further catalyzed the shift towards online booking platforms, with the majority of users now preferring to book flights via smartphones or tablets. Mobile apps offer seamless navigation, instant notifications, and integration with digital wallets, making the entire booking and travel experience more convenient and user-friendly.
The Future of Flight Ticket Booking:
As technology continues to evolve, the future of flight ticket booking is poised for further innovation and disruption. Emerging trends such as artificial intelligence, blockchain, and augmented reality hold the potential to revolutionize how we search, book, and experience air travel.
A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ants are poised to become integral parts of the booking process, providing personalized recommendations, proactive assistance, and instant support round-the-clock. Blockchain technology promises enhanced security, transparency, and efficiency in transactions, while augmented reality could revolutionize the pre-flight experience with immersive previews of cabins, amenities, and destinations.
Conclusion:
The evolution of flight ticket booking from traditional travel agencies to online platforms has democratized access to air travel, empowering consumers with unprecedented choice, convenience, and control. While travel agencies continue to cater to niche markets and personalized services, online booking platforms have become the go-to option for mainstream travelers seeking efficiency, affordability, and flexibility.
As we embrace the digital age of travel, it's essential to recognize the transformative impact of technology on how we discover, plan, and embark on journeys around the globe. With continued innovation and adaptation, the future of flight ticket booking holds boundless possibilities for enhancing the travel experience for generations to come.
